First-graders in a North Jersey school are always in motion during class, but that's OK.

Kids in Paramus are cycling while they read or write.

The class has had 10 pedaling desk cycles since the school year started.

The cycles donated by a local hospital seem to be the solution to fidgety youngsters.

So far, excuses to get up and distractions caused by wiggling are down.

There aren't enough of these desk cycles for everybody, but the class is so happy with the results they may try a fundraiser to buy more cycles, which cost about $150 each.
